From deae1657ee6dd6f7b3effab3d44429d5434f5bbf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: David Rowley Date: Wed, 2 Aug 2023 01:39:47 +1200 Subject: [PATCH] Fix overly strict Assert in jsonpath code This was failing for queries which try to get the .type() of a jpiLikeRegex. For example: select jsonb_path_query('["string", "string"]', '($[0] like_regex ".{7}").type()'); Reported-by: Alexander Kozhemyakin Bug: #18035 Discussion: https://postgr.es/m/18035-64af5cdcb5adf2a9@postgresql.org Backpatch-through: 12, where SQL/JSON path was added. --- src/backend/utils/adt/jsonpath.c | 3 ++- 1 file changed, 2 insertions(+), 1 deletion(-) diff --git a/src/backend/utils/adt/jsonpath.c b/src/backend/utils/adt/jsonpath.c index 7891fde310..c5ba3b7f1d 100644 --- a/src/backend/utils/adt/jsonpath.c +++ b/src/backend/utils/adt/jsonpath.c @@ -1014,7 +1014,8 @@ jspGetNext(JsonPathItem *v, JsonPathItem *a) v->type == jpiDouble || v->type == jpiDatetime || v->type == jpiKeyValue || - v->type == jpiStartsWith); + v->type == jpiStartsWith || + v->type == jpiLikeRegex); if (a) jspInitByBuffer(a, v->base, v->nextPos);
